Rabbit anti-Human CASTOR1 Polyclonal Antibody

The antibody against CASTOR1 was raised in Rabbit using the recombinant fusion protein containing a sequence corresponding to amino acids 1-329 of human CASTOR1 (NP_001032755.1) as the immunogen. The polyclonal antibody exists as a isotype IgG, by affinity purification. This antibody has been validated on WB, IHC-P, IF/ICC, ELISA.

  • Target Full Name

    Cytosolic arginine sensor for mTORC1 subunit 1

  • Target Function

    Functions as an intracellular arginine sensor within the amino acid-sensing branch of the TORC1 signaling pathway. As a homodimer or a heterodimer with CASTOR2, binds and inhibits the GATOR subcomplex GATOR2 and thereby mTORC1. Binding of arginine to CASTOR1 allosterically disrupts the interaction of CASTOR1-containing dimers with GATOR2 which can in turn activate mTORC1 and the TORC1 signaling pathway.
